Et pourquoi pas OpenSolaris 1
C’est la reflexion que je me suis faite il y a une semaine. OpenSolaris est le projet d’ouverture du code du système d’exploitationSolaris de Sun Microsystem (voir la définition wikipedia). Ce projet à été lancé en 2005 (si je ne me trompe pas). C’est une bonne chose.
Beaucoup ce demandais pourquoi Sun (créateur de java, mais surtout fournisseur de machine et processeur Sparc) n’avais pas rempalcé son système unix propriétaire par un linux retravaillé (comme IBM et d’autres ont pu le faire). J’avoue que je suis content de la voie prise par Sun. Ce qui me plait dans le libre, ou même en général, c’est d’avoir le choix. Le choix c’est une forme de liberté. Ouvrir le code de leur système permet de le faire connaitre et évoluer plus facilement, plus rapidement.
Un autre point à joué dans mon choix, mon envie de tester OpenSolaris. Ian Murdock le papa de Debian a rejoint Sun pour travailler sur OpenSolaris ! C’est une bonne nouvelle. Cela montre aussi que Sun ne fait pas cette ouverture par effet de mode, mais croit dans le mode de distribution libre (Java aussi est en train de devenir libre ;-) ).
Basé sur Gnome, le bureau et les application sont assez complète. Même si en regardant sous le capot il y a pas mal de chose très différentes, cela reste un Unix, et on ne s’y perd pas trop trop.
Bon j’ai quand même pas mal de chose à apprendre sur ce système. Je vous en ferais part au fur et à mesure. Si jamais vous voulez l’essayer ça pourrais servir. Moi ça me fera un pense-bête ;-)
J'ai craqué 1
J'ai une grosse tendance à me disperser. Plein d'idée en tête, plein de nouveauté à explorer. (quel rapport avec le titre ? J'y viens).
Quand j'ai découvert en 2000 qu'il existait autre chose que windows pour les station de travail, j'ai voulu en savoir plus. J'ai donc installé mon premier linux et exploré la bête. Je ne regrette pas. Puis sont venu les découverte de BeOS, reactOs, QNX, *BSD... Je crois avoir essayer chacun d'eux (un doute sur reactOS). Celui qui ma le plus marqué c'est OpenBSD. Mais voilà, OpenBSD n'est pas orienté (pour le moment) UserFriendly clickodromesque. Pour un utilisateur comme moi c'est un peu délicat. J'apprend beaucoup, mais je n'arrive pas à avoir une station de travail où je suis efficace.
Du coup, j'ai craqué. Pour continuer mon expériences avec OpenBSD, n'ayant pas d'autres machine que mon mac mini sous la main (pour le moment), j'ai souscript à l'offre dédibox pour bénéficier d'une machine de "location" qui pourras me servir de serveur (:)) mais surtout de zone d'apprentissage. Je sais qu'OpenBSD n'est pas suporté officiellement, mais j'ai vu que plusieurs personnes ont mis en place des solutions simple pour palier à ce manque: http://open.bsdedibox.net/, et le wiki officieux des installations bsd sur dedibox. Comme ça je vais pouvoir continuer à apprendre à me servir d'OpenBSD, sans les aspect station de travail c'est dommage, mais c'est déjà ça. Du coup je garde une Debian, ma distribution linux préféré :), pour mac mini. Avec Debian, j'arrive à m'installer un environnement efficace.
J'espère qu'un jour j'arreterais de changer de système toute les semaines, ça seras plus facile pour pouvoir avancer dans les projets que j'ai en tête. Je compte sur ces 30 euros par moi pour me permettre d'avancer. En tout cas ça me permettras de me prosterner devant la puissance et la grace d'openBSD tout en utilisant l'efficacité d'une distribution Debian.
Une ligne éditoriale sur un blog ? Oui ça permet d'être plus cohérent. Mais après tout ici c'est comme indiqué dans le titre, une extension de mon esprit. Mes billets suivent le vent de mes idées.
Debian Etch 6
Debian prépare la sortie de sa version 3.2 (debian Etch). Normalement prévu pour décembre, une page sur le wiki est désormais disponible et contient toute les nouveautés de Etch.
On peut voir aussi quelque copie d'écran du nouvel installeur graphique et en couleur :).
Debian prend le temps de faire les choses, mais les faits bien. C'est vraiment ma distribution préférée !!
Edit: On m'a souffler qu'une erreur c'est glissé dans le contenu de ce billet... C'est evidemment la 3.2 et non la 3.1 de debian qui vas sortir. La 3.1 etant la version stable actuelle (Sarge) Merci à LordPhoenix. pour la correction ;-)
Happy Birthday Debian 2
Et oui, c'est le 16 aout 1993 que Ian Murdock annonçait une nouvelle distribution GNU/Linux: Debian
Le message de Ian sur comp.os.linux.development
13 ans... Une bien belle réussite quand on vois combien de distribution se base sur debian ! Même si ce n'etais pas le but premier de cette distribution. D'ailleurs, Etch devrais être là pour Décembre.
Longue Vie à debian !
Window Maker Theme : Tango 8
J’avais très envie d’adapter le projet Tango a Window Maker. C’est un projet très interessant à propos de l’interface utilisateur. Sous le couvert de freedesktop, ce projet regroupe une série d’icones et une charte graphique.
J’ai donc basé mon theme windowmaker dessus en récupérant les icones officiel, et d’autres non officiel pour compléter (surtout au niveau des applications). voilà ce que ça donne:
J’utilise deux bureau sous WindowMaker. L’un pour tout ce qui touche au web: Firefox, Xchat, gAim, gftp…. L’autre pour le reste: console, gimp, scite, rox…
Pour dans les paquets d’icones officiel il n’y avais pas d’icone en 48×48 ni en 64×64 en png. J’ai donc ecrit un petit quelque chose pour passer de SVG à 64×64 et 48×48. je l’ai mis dans ma zone. Ca contient un script sh pour l’appel à inkscape (c’est via inkscape de que je transforme du svg au png avec une taille donné en paramètre) et un petit script ruby pour parcourir un repertoire, appeler le script qui vas bien et créer le repertoire avec les nouveaux icones. C’est un peu brut de fonderie, c’est sans license, donc completement public (enfin sauf si on me dit le contraire). Pour lancer il suffit d’ouvrir le script ruby et de modifier les 4 premières variables :). J’ai aussi mis dedans toutes les icones que j’ai trouvé sur le theme de Tango…
Pour ce qui est de windowmaker, je suis pas encore un professionnel de la construction de theme. Alors j’ai compacté ce qui à été généré dans le repertoire theme de windowmaker.
Bon maintenant que c’est fait, j’ai eu des pépins (encore..) sous windowmaker. Ca m’était déjà arrivé, Xorg Freeze et pas possible de revenir ou tué x. Donc je suis de retour sous xfce :). Vivement que j’ai plus de place pour avoir plusieurs machine, ça me permettras d’avoir sur chacune un des window managers que j’adore :-p.
[Gestionnaire de fenêtre] WindowMaker come back !
Site à mes précédents problèmes avec Xfce j’ai donc basculer sous Windowmaker.
C’est tout le paradoxe des Unices libres (Gnu/linux et autres *BSD). Y’a tellement de choix qu’il est dur d’en faire un. Dans le cas qui nous interesse, les gestionnaires de fenêtre: ils pullulent ! Pas un mois sans que j’en découvre un nouveau !
C’est le genre de discussion qui peut vite tourner au troll… :)
Déjà, il y a pour moi quelques grande familles: Les complets clickodrome qui sont très bien quand on à une bonne machine et que l’on ne cherche pas à savoir comment sont faites les choses en dessous. J’entends par là Gnome et KDE. Même si j’ai découvert linux sous KDE, j’ai une préférence pour Gnome aujourd’hui. Mais aucun des deux ne me convient car ils ne viennent jamais seul, regardez le nombre de Kmachintruc ou de Gbidulechose qui viennent avec ces deux là :-)
Ensuite y’a toutes les *Box. Simple, leger, c’est surtout pour les passionnés de la console. Fluxbox, Blackbox, OpenBox et j’en oublie surement. C’est sympa, j’ai fait tourner un peu OpenBOX, j’avais trouvé ça agréable, simple. Mais ça ne me vas pas non plus…
Ensuite y’a les ovnis: Ion par exemple c’est un windowmanager qui n’utilise pas la souris. Bon j’ai pas vraiment essayer.
On pourrais les ranger dans les Ovnis, mais ils sont assez répendu, alors c’est plus des ovnis :-p. Xfce j’en parles un peu dans mon précédent poste. J’avoue que dans les Gestionnaire un peu clickodrome, c’est mon préféré !.
L’autres Ovni c’est WindowMaker ! Basé sur GNUStep qui se veux l’implémentation libre de NextSTEP, base sur laquel Apple à pondu Mac OS X. Moi j’adore son coté décalé !. Je suis un fan, même si certaine fonctions clickdromesque me manque parfois (genre montage automatique de mon appareil photo). Mais au vue de mes problèmes avec Xfce, j’ai décidé de m’y consacrer un peu plus !
A vrai dire, j’ai déjà un petit quelque chose pour windowmaker en route, on reparleras très prochainement… ;-)
Xfce: consommation CPU, dommage 2
Dire que je m’était décidé à utiliser Xfce tout le temps…
Xfce c’est le gestionnaire de fenêtre qui est souvent appelé le petit frère de Gnome. Surement parce qu’il utilise lui aussi GTK comme librairie graphique. Mais il est plus léger que Gnome. En fait c’est surement parce qu’il intègre beaucoup moins de fonctionnalité divers. De plus il n’embarque pas avec lui tout une série d’application plus ou moins obligatoire (genre Evolution, Synaptic,…). Attention je n’ai rien contre ces applications (j’utilise Synaptic comme gestionnaire de paquets), mais j’aime avoir le choix.
Donc j’utilise Xfce, mais ces dernire temps j’avais une consommation de CPU un peu trop forte…
Tout a commencé quand j’ai supprimer le repertoire Desktop de mon HOME. Ca ma supprimer les icones placer sur le bureau. Je pensais me pencher sur le problème plus tard. Mais maintenant à chaque fois que je veut glisser un dossier sur le bureau, le CPU s’emballe, et le pire c’est qu’il ne s’arrête pas :’(
Je vais essayer de réparer le coup du Desktop effacer, peut-être ça reviendras à la normal.
Edit: Je viens de remettre en place le repertoire Desktop (je l’avais fait, mais en me trompant dans la casse, j’avais mis desktop au lieu de Desktop). Ca me permet de pouvoir remanipuler des éléments avec le bureau, mais cependant, j’ai toujours le problème de CPU…
Retour au clickodrome 2
Et oui en revenant sous debian, j’ai commencé par reprendre ce bon vieux gnome. J’aime beaucoup les rendus GTK. Je trouve gnome très agréable, et depuis la 2.14 j’avoue que tout vas plus vite ;-).
Mais voilà: gnome, tout comme kde, s’intalle avec un tas de petit utilitaires très pratique, mais que je n’ai pas choisi. J’aime les programmes qui ne font qu’une seul chose, mais bien. J’ai donc décidé de voir ou en était xfce
Environnement / gestionnaire de fenêtre utilisant également gtk, il ne fait que ce qu’il est sensé faire: gérer mon bureau et mes fenêtres. De plus dans les dernière version (4.3 pour debian etch) on bénéficie des changements programmé pour la 4.4 (qui viens de sortir en béta… vite vite vite dans les depots debian ;-) ).
Voici ce que l’on arrive à obtenir:
Dans les environnement clickodrome, je dirais que je conseillerais gnome pour les débutants, et xfce pour les confirmés… Mais peut-être qu’avec la 4.4, xfce pourrais très bien aller au débutants également !
OpenBSD mon bilan
Après plus d’un mois d’apprentissage, de manipulations, c’est l’heure de faire un topo sur OpenBSD pour l’architecture PowerPC.
Pour commencer, OpenBSD et son meneur Theo de Raadt, ont une façon de voir le libre qui me plait bien. La pochette des CDs de la 3.9 presente toute une histoire autour des Blobs. Les Blobs sont les drivers et autres librairies binaire fourni gracieusement par certains fabriquants. Oui elle sont gratuites mais loin d’être libre, en tout cas leurs code n’est pas ouvert. OpenBSD, contrairement à GNU/Linux, refuse catégoriquement d’intégrer ce genre de programme dans son système. Un très bon point que j’apprecie énormement !
La façon dont est developpé OpenBSD, avec un cercle restreint de personne permet d’obtenir un “core” OpenBSD très homogène. C’est assez agréable. Ce nombre restreint d’intervenant est surement aussi à la base d’un autre problème: le manque de paquets disponible, le manque de petit outils/scripts qui font que l’on peut se faire une station de travail sans ecrire un seul script.
Finalement j’ai passé plus de temps à découvrir un tas de chose sur la gestion des montages (clé usb, appareil photos numérique, cd), à voir comment configurer finement le fichier sudo, à régler l’antialiasing, à mettre un xorg.conf correspondant au mieux à mon écran. Bref, un tas de petites chose qui manque pour un utilisateur lambda comme moi.
Alors voilà, comme j’ai un tas d’autres chose en tête que j’aimerais réaliser (notament autour de Ruby), j’ai décider de remettre une debian sur ma machine. Non pas parce que je n’aime plus OpenBSD, au contraire ! Ce mois d’essai ma permis de me rendre compte que j’aime la philo BSD, et encore plus celle d’OpenBSD ! C’est pour sur un projet que je vais suivre, pour lequel je ferais surement des dons.
En attendant je suis revenu à ma distribution GNU/Linux préféré: debian:
Je pense que tant qu’a faire je vais aller me renseigner un peu plus sur le projet Debian/BSD. Comme vous le savez surement déjà, debian essaie d’être une surcouche à gnu/linux et de nombreux projet vise à pourvoir utiliser debian sur un noyau hurd, darwin et aussi bsd. Je vais aller vois ça. C’est peut-être ce qu’il me faut finalement ;-)
Quoiqu’il arrive, j’acheterais les CDs d’OpenBSD 4.0 et dès que j’ai une deuxième machine à la maison, je met un OpenBSD dessus pour continuer mon apprentissage des Unices ;-)
Vive OpenBSD !!!
Aux utilisateurs de Flash 1
C'est beau le vectoriel, j'aime bien aussi cette techno. Mais pas avec Flash... Fermé, ce format ne me plait pas. D'autant plus que du coup il ne fonctionne pas sous toute les architecture. Par exemple, que ça soit avec mon ancienne Debian ou mon OpenBSD du moment, ben je peut pas le lire. Il n'existe pas de plugin flash pour firefox pour linux (ou bsd) pour les architecture powerpc... Alors si on prend un netbsd qui marche même sur un grille pain je vous raconte pas la faible couverture de l'engin.
Et pourtant on en vois de plus en plus. Le petit plugin pour écouter les podcasts, pour visualiser une vidéo. Le site lafraise.com en est malheuresement équipé ce qui m'empêche de voter pour les visuels (malheuresement pour moi, mais heuresement pour mon vote, au boulot je suis sous windows...)
L'exellent site qui parle des format ouverts frappe encore une fois. Effectivement il y a encore une agence web qui à cru bon de faire un site tout en flash, et les formats ouverts nous explique encore une fois pourquoi ce n'est pas bon du tout. A noter la petit pointe d'humour puisque Ten-Mobile.com (puisque c'est d'eux dont il s'agit) a le bon gout d'utiliser la phrase:
Si votre mobile ne fait que téléphoner, il ne fait pas grand chose.Et comme le sougligne Thierry Stoehr, on pourrais ajouter:
Comme votre site Web ne fait que du Flash, il ne fait pas grand chose.J'adore !
Vive le monde libre (c'est à dire basé sur des formats ouverts) ;-)






